The more and more I watch Star Wars, whether the movies, clone wars, or Rebels, the more I think that vehicle scale damage is a mistake.
There are so many examples of characters shooting vehicles and damaging them enough that they crash or cease to function, not to mention examples of the characters on foot bening shot at my vehicles and not being vapourized immediately.
I understand why the scale disparity exists, partly to keep things separate combat wise, so a hold out blaster doesn't take out a TIE fighter, as well as "it has always been done this way".
Now, I think being shot at by a vehicle weapons should have other advantages, but the x10 damage and armour as written doesn't seem to be the best option.
